Well (my final bit of advice, then I'll shut up), if you've got a Halfords shop anywhere nearby (and they're pretty much everywhere), then I strongly recommend their matt black spray paint. £7.49 for a socking great 500ml can. And it's an excellent product too. Flat matt, jet black, smooth texture, high opacity.
A better product and at a much cheaper price than most 'hobby brand' spray primers. (GW spray paints are £11 for a smaller can, and the paint's not as good).

http://www.halfords.com/motoring-travel/cleaning-body-repair/car-spray-paints/halfords-matt-black-paint-500ml

A bit more expensive, but better still - and what I use almost exclusively these days - is Halfords camo brown spray paint.
Easier on the eye than black, and a great finish to paint on. Ultra matt. Especially good for horses, but I use it for everything.
